Samuel H. Schwartz is a notable inventor based in Penn Valley, PA, with a remarkable portfolio of six patents. His work primarily focuses on enhancing user interaction with technology, particularly in the realm of video content and voice-activated systems.
Latest Patents
One of his latest patents is titled "Remote access to personal video profile." This system provides a user-specific list of programs for online viewing based on a user profile stored in a DVR. The system includes a preference server linked to a wide area network, which communicates with the DVR and at least one content server that has a library of programs available for online delivery to a remote device. Additionally, it features a User Menu hosted by the preference server, tailored to the user, providing a specific list of programs based on the user profile stored in the DVR.
Another significant patent is "Determining context to initiate interactivity." This invention discloses methods and systems for executing a voice command based on the association of the voice command with one or more identifiers. The system receives audio data associated with a content asset at a user device, such as a voice-activated device. It also receives a voice command at the user device. The identifiers associated with the audio data may be determined based on playback of the content asset or may be received in response to a request generated by the user device. The user device can then determine and initiate operations based on the identifiers and the received voice command.

Samuel has worked with prominent companies, including Comcast Cable Communications, LLC, and Comcast Cable Communications Management, LLC. His experience in these organizations has contributed significantly to his innovative developments in technology.
